Eintracht Frankfurt pulled off a shock 3-1 upset over Bayern Munich to win their first DFB Pokal since 1998 on Saturday.
Bayern were beaten 4-1...
We use cookies to ensure that we give you the best experience on our website. If you continue to use this site we will assume that you are happy with it.Ok